Nematode species may travel throughout the bodies of the fish affecting their vital organs such as the liver, kidneys, etc. The fishes die when the nematodes result in secondary infections in these vital organs.

WebAug 21, 2024 · Capillaria Species. The Capillarids as a group can infect a wide variety of fish hosts. Capillaria pterophylli is a relatively common nematode seen in the intestines of cichlids (including angelfish and discus). Capillaria species are also seen in cyprinids, …
WebAnisakiasis is a parasitic disease caused by anisakid nematodes (worms) that can invade the stomach wall or intestine of humans. The larval nematodes grow to maturity, and the marine mammal excretes the nematode eggs into the sea where they hatch. Shrimp-like animals eat the larvae, and fish eat the shrimp-like animals. The larvae then develop into the form we see in fish. crystal corporate center boca raton
